Green Seal program to recognize sustainable companies



Oct. 29

Green Seal has launched a new program to recognize truly sustainable U.S. companies to help consumers cut through misleading environmental claims and greenwashing.

The group´s Laureate Program will use science-based standards to identify consumer product companies´ environmentally friendly products. Its requirements are life-cycle based and focused on energy use, air and water impacts, waste, toxic chemicals and other standards.

Laureate recognition is not a one-time deal. Green Seal, an independent, third-party group, will monitor companies regularly to ensure their products´ performance. More information is available at www.greenseal.org .
